This essay examines the technical and ethical implications of the Borderlands 3: Ultimate Edition release on the Nintendo Switch, specifically focusing on the distribution formats used in the emulation and modding communities—namely NSP and XCI files. The Porting Miracle

When Gearbox announced that Borderlands 3 would be ported to the Nintendo Switch, the gaming community was skeptical. The game is notoriously demanding on hardware, often struggling to maintain consistent frame rates even on base PlayStation 4 and Xbox One consoles. However, the "Ultimate Edition" on Switch is widely considered a "technical miracle," delivering the full experience—including all six DLCs and bonus content packs—on a handheld device. File Formats: NSP vs. XCI

In the context of the Nintendo Switch ecosystem, particularly for users interested in digital archiving or custom firmware, two primary file formats dominate:

NSP (Nintendo Submission Package): This format mimics the digital downloads found on the Nintendo eShop. For Borderlands 3, the NSP is the standard way the base game and its numerous updates and DLCs are packaged. Because the Ultimate Edition includes so much content, the total file size is substantial, often requiring users to manage their storage carefully.

XCI (NX Card Image): This format is a "dump" of a physical game cartridge. While Borderlands 3 had a physical release, the cartridge often only contains a portion of the game data, requiring a massive day-one download. An "updated" XCI usually refers to a modified file where the base game, all patches, and all DLCs have been "built-in" or bundled together for easier installation. The Borderlands 3: Ultimate Edition for Nintendo Switch, released on October 6, 2023, includes the base game and all major DLC expansions. While early physical box art incorrectly listed a 62 GB requirement, the game was significantly optimized for the platform. Update and Version Information

Latest Major Update: Version 1.0.3, released on November 20, 2023.

Performance Improvements: This update provided a notable "boost" to frame rates (targeting 30 FPS more consistently), visual and audio fidelity, and matchmaking stability.

Bug Fixes: Resolved progression blockers in missions like "Blood Drive" and "Lair of the Harpy," and fixed crashes occurring during map transitions or new game starts.

Critical Note: Some players reported issues with the 1.0.3 update, including potential inventory wipes, micro-stutters, and bank size resets. Storage and File Sizes

The game uses a modular installation system, allowing players to download the base game and DLCs individually to manage storage. Total Full Installation ~23.5 GB Base Game Only ~8.5 GB to 9.4 GB Total DLC Content ~15 GB Minimum Required Download ~11.57 GB (per eShop fine print)

Released on October 6, 2023, Borderlands 3 Ultimate Edition on the Nintendo Switch provides the complete looter-shooter experience, bundling the base game with all major content expansions and bonus packs. Developed by Gearbox Software and published by 2K, this version was significantly optimized to fit the Switch's hardware constraints while maintaining the series' signature "mayhem". Included Content

This edition is the most comprehensive version of the game available, featuring: Base Game: The full award-winning Borderlands 3 campaign.

Four Campaign DLCs: Includes Moxxi’s Heist of the Handsome Jackpot, Guns, Love, and Tentacles, Bounty of Blood, and Psycho Krieg and the Fantastic Fustercluck.

Extra Content Add-ons: Includes the Designer's Cut (featuring "Arms Race" mode) and the Director’s Cut (featuring a raid boss and behind-the-scenes content).

Bonus Cosmetics: Over 30 cosmetic items and packs, such as the Butt Stallion, Retro, Neon, and Gearbox Cosmetic Packs. Performance & Technical Details

File Size Optimization: While the physical box art originally listed a 62 GB requirement, the actual optimized file size is approximately 23.5 GB. Base Game: ~8.5 GB. DLCs: ~15 GB (can be installed individually to save space).

Frame Rate & Resolution: The game runs at an uncapped frame rate, typically hovering between 40-50 FPS, with occasional dips to 30 FPS during intense combat.

Multiplayer: Supports up to two-player co-op via local wireless or online play (note: split-screen is not supported on Switch).

Switch Features: Includes full gyro aiming support and compatibility with the Nintendo Switch Pro Controller. Physical vs. Digital

The physical version contains only a small portion of the game (approx. 3.1 GB to 8.5 GB) on the cartridge, requiring a significant mandatory download to access the full game and all DLC content. Digital buyers can purchase directly through the Nintendo eShop.
